WebA service animal is not limited to one or two breeds of dogs. Any breed of dog can be a service animal, assuming the dog has been individually trained to assist an individual with a disability with specific tasks. An assistance dog pressing a button to open an automatic door. In general, an assistance dog, known as a service dog in the United States, is a dog trained to aid or assist an individual with a disability.
